About Kinchaiputtu Village
Kinchaiputtu is a small village in Munchingi Puttu tehsil, in the district of Visakhapatnam, Andhra Pradesh. The Census of India 2011 recorded a population of 251, made up of 114 males and 137 females. That works out to a sex ratio of about 1,202 females per 1000 males. The village covers 67 hectares hectares. Its pincode is 531040, shared with the other villages in the same post office area.

Getting to Kinchaiputtu
The census records public bus service for Kinchaiputtu as Available within village. Private bus service is recorded as Available within 10+ km distance. For rail, the census notes the nearest railway station as Available within 10+ km distance. These entries describe what was recorded in 2011 and services may have changed since.
